This topic comes from personal experience and curiosity about my own choices in my 20's. I had a thing for torturing myself with unhealthy relationships. Much of my story comes from trying to heal from these toxic relationships after my confidence was torn down, my perception of reality was so skewed, and I didn't think I could trust myself anymore.

It only makes sense that I get a therapist on the show to dive into all of it!

Natalie Hartney is a board-certified counselor working in private practice since 2014, and she's the host of the Bad Childhood By The Optimistic Therapist podcast. You can hear the empathy in her voice when she talks about toxic relationships, she offers so much perspective. I know you'll love this conversation!
